Detailed Description

This Class provides the parameters for the static OD adjustment experiment

Constructor & Destructor Documentation

◆ MacroAdjustmentExperiment()

MacroAdjustmentExperiment::MacroAdjustmentExperiment ( )

◆ ~MacroAdjustmentExperiment()

MacroAdjustmentExperiment::~MacroAdjustmentExperiment ( )

Member Function Documentation

◆ getGradientDescentIterations()

uint MacroAdjustmentExperiment::getGradientDescentIterations ( ) const

Get the gradient descent iterations

◆ getOuterIterations()

uint MacroAdjustmentExperiment::getOuterIterations ( ) const

Get the number of outer iterations

◆ getOutput()

MacroAdjustmentOutput * MacroAdjustmentExperiment::getOutput ( )

Get the output of the adjustment process

◆ getParams()

const MacroAdjustmentScenarioParams & MacroAdjustmentExperiment::getParams ( ) const

Get the Static OD Adjustment parameters for this scenario

◆ getTargetR2()

double MacroAdjustmentExperiment::getTargetR2 ( ) const

Get the target R2

◆ getTargetSlopeDev()

double MacroAdjustmentExperiment::getTargetSlopeDev ( ) const

Get the target slope deviation

◆ setDefaultParamsForAllUserClasses()

void MacroAdjustmentExperiment::setDefaultParamsForAllUserClasses ( float  alpha = 1.0f,
float  tripLengthDistributionElasticity = 0.5f 
)

Set default macro adjustment parameters for each user class in the scenario's demand

◆ setGradientDescentIterations()

void MacroAdjustmentExperiment::setGradientDescentIterations ( uint  value)

Set the gradient descent iterations

◆ setOuterIterations()

void MacroAdjustmentExperiment::setOuterIterations ( uint  value)

Set the number of outer iterations

◆ setParams()

void MacroAdjustmentExperiment::setParams ( const MacroAdjustmentScenarioParams params)

Set the Static OD Adjustment parameters for this scenario

◆ setTargetR2()

void MacroAdjustmentExperiment::setTargetR2 ( double  targetR2)

Set the target R2

◆ setTargetSlopeDev()

void MacroAdjustmentExperiment::setTargetSlopeDev ( double  targetSlopeDev)

Sets the target slope deviation

◆ setTripMatrix()

void MacroAdjustmentExperiment::setTripMatrix ( GKODMatrix iMatrix)

Sets the additional goal Trip Matrix for the static OD adjustment. Data loaded from params.

◆ setTripMatrixCentroidGrouping()

void MacroAdjustmentExperiment::setTripMatrixCentroidGrouping ( GKGroup iGroup)

Sets the Grouping Category of Centroids used to aggregate zones for Trip Matrix processing. Data loaded from params.

◆ setTripMatrixReliability()

void MacroAdjustmentExperiment::setTripMatrixReliability ( double  iFactor)

Sets the Trip Matrix Reliability factor for the static OD adjustment. Data loaded from params.

◆ tripMatrix()

GKODMatrix * MacroAdjustmentExperiment::tripMatrix ( ) const

Returns the additional goal Trip Matrix for the static OD adjustment. Data stored in params.

◆ tripMatrixCentroidGrouping()

GKGroup * MacroAdjustmentExperiment::tripMatrixCentroidGrouping ( ) const

Returns the Grouping Category of Centroids used to aggregate zones for Trip Matrix processing. Data stored in params.

◆ tripMatrixReliability()

double MacroAdjustmentExperiment::tripMatrixReliability ( ) const

Returns the Trip Matrix Reliability factor for the static OD adjustment. Data stored in params.
